Mikheev Philip Egorovich

Definition:

Manager of the Leningrad Regional Committee and City Committee of the All-Union Communist Party (Bolsheviks)

Years of life: 1902-1975
Reproduction methods:

Genus. in 1902 in the village. Chernoyarovo, Tver province; Russian; former member of the CPSU(b) since 1926. Manager of the affairs of the Leningrad regional committee and city committee of the CPSU(b). Arrested 08/05/1949. Convicted under the so-called "Leningrad case" to 10 years in prison. Sentenced by the Military Collegium of the Supreme Court of the USSR on September 30, 1950 under Art. 58-1 “a”, 58-7, 58-11 of the Criminal Code of the RSFSR to 10 years in prison. He was kept in Vladimir prison. Released in 1954. Rehabilitated.
